Guess i must be the rare case where i can honestly say good riddance had one engine built by ERL. A 434ci dry sleeve for a G8. Engine was fully assembled by erl not just a short block was put in the car and the valvetrain was so noisy they shut it down it would also idle smoothly at 550rpm with a 237/247 cam. Long story short the pushrods they put in it were WAY and i mean WAY short over 125 thou. They did replace them on the dyno. Then after it was tuned we found out the thing really didnt carry good oil pressure when it was hot. The clearances in it werent good for what they knew the engine was going to be used for. A street performance build. Anyway they never made it right i got basically the run around. Oh also took them about 4 months longer than i was told to get the engine. It never laid down the power it should have either. Ended up taking it back out tearing it down and redoing it. Picked up oil pressure as well as about 75hp.
